The first thing that stands out about the artistry of this small antique Persian Farahan carpet is its use of concentric medallion designs that divide the field, working from the center outward. The Islimi pattern uses alternating fields of brilliant reds, midnight blues, and ivory, highlighted with floral motifs and high-contrast colors.
The central rug medallion design provides an organizational theme that echoes throughout the entire Persian rug. The border of the antique rug is understated as compared to the design of the field, highlighting the large-scale sweeping design of the central field.
